crop_rec_4k_mlv_snd_isogain_1x3_presets_toggle

View source
crop_rec_4k_mlv_snd_isogain_1x3_presets_toggle
  • Contributors
    1. Loading...
Author Commit Message Date Builds
Jip de Beer
mlv_lite.c:(Hide Data format in RAW video submenu.)
Jip de Beer
Merged with latest changes by Danne. Kept some of my own.
danne
crop_rec.c:(EOSM preset index updated)
danne
crop-mode-hack.c,crop_rec.c:(EOSM,100D,5D3, autoenable modules on install. Even works with disabling. Thanks Jip-Hop for completing the circle. COnfig files changes in crop_rec.c and also menu rearragements accordingly)
Jip de Beer
crop-mode-hack.c(Alternative first run check, based on existence of magic.cfg)
Jip de Beer
Merged with latest changes by Danne.
Jip de Beer
crop-mode-hack.c:(EOSM, Load modules only on first run. Allows for modules to be disabled manually.)
danne
crop_rec.c:(Formatting, keep forgetting. Stay off text editor...)
danne
crop_rec.c:(EOSM added set_25fps to Switch section. New helps texts. Thanks Jip-Hop)
danne
crop_rec.c:(formatting)
danne
crop_rec.c:(EOSM fix for when changing bitdepth between rewired and non rewired modes)
danne
crop_rec.c:(EOSM bugs around ratios, MAX name causing conflicts, unclear how, set to OFF for now, ratio coherency between Crop mode sub menu and Switch menu)
danne
crop-mode-hack.c:(Skip the autoenabling stuff)
danne
crop-mode-hack.c:(Enable modules by default)
danne
crop_rec.c:(EOSM global ratio now working as well as customized for each Switch preset. Thanks Jip-Hop)
danne
crop_rec.c:(turning off Switch menu for other cameras but eosm. Jip-Hop fix)
danne
crop_rec.c:(EOSM and only eosm atm)
danne
crop_rec.c:(EOSM missing code parts around Switch button routines handed over from Jip-Hop)
danne
crop_rec.c:(Jip-Hop collaboration, various ideas around button pushes, fast acces to presaved slots etc)
Jip de Beer
crop_rec.c:(Assign proper default values for Slot A and B.)
Jip de Beer
crop_rec.c:(One global ratio setting for all presets, or override ratio in their submenu. Also fixed a bug where individual ratio settings wouldn't save correctly.)
Jip de Beer
crop_rec.c:(EOSM, Restored some of the nice original formatting thanks to Danne.)
Jip de Beer
crop_rec.c:(EOSM, Use INFO key to cycle LV as normal when not in the LV with ML overlays.)
Jip de Beer
scripts:(Removed cine.lua. Functionality is now built in Switch menu.)
Jip de Beer
crop_rec.c:(Fixed code formatting issues that sneaked in from out of nowhere.)
Jip de Beer
crop_rec.c:(Block INFO key during recording only. Blocked it in too many places.)
Jip de Beer
crop_rec.c:(Block INFO key during recording, otherwise recording will stop.)
Jip de Beer
crop_rec.c:(EOSM,Explain about continuous recording in help text)
Jip de Beer
Make toggling presets seem more responsive, by notifying ahead of time where we're going to toggle into.
Jip de Beer
Automatically enable some modules.
Jip de Beer
Allow a little customization for each preset in Switch menu: select ratios in submenu.
Jip de Beer
Fixed mistake in help text.
Jip de Beer
Set relevant settings like in cine.lua script. Applied each time a preset is applied via Switch menu (or with keys configured by Switch menu).
Jip de Beer
Changed a TODO in comments.
Jip de Beer
Max out resolution in RAW video module when applying a preset.
Jip de Beer
Wrote menu help text, small menu name changes.
Jip de Beer
Made method for common code.
Jip de Beer
Fix to properly apply presets from ML menu.
Jip de Beer
Found better way to fake keys.
Jip de Beer
Variable rename.
Jip de Beer
Restored crop_rec submenu to how Danne had it initially. Switch menu can now optionally be disabled. Should also not show Switch menu on cameras other than EOSM.
Jip de Beer
Follow naming convention for presets in Switch menu.
Jip de Beer
Removed unused line of code.
Jip de Beer
Menu entries in presets_toggler_menu can now be reordered without breaking functionality (was relying on indices before). Should be easier to maintain this way.
Jip de Beer
Check for NULL before doing streq. Otherwise console will pop up.
Jip de Beer
Removed unused code which prevented LV refresh after settings change.
Jip de Beer
Moved preset slots to bottom. No longer rely on entry index when assigning choices.
Jip de Beer
Moved and renamed menu item for x3toggle. Added new help text.
Jip de Beer
Fix double press INFO not registered because two variables aren't reset when returning early (only happened when both preset slots were empty).
Jip de Beer
Replaced two strings in comments I missed before.
Jip de Beer
Toggle high framerate with double press of SET key.
Jip de Beer
Restructured code for better overview. Prepare for double SET press.
Jip de Beer
Auto format document with Visual Studio Code to fix indentation.
Jip de Beer
x3toggle only with SET key, or deactivate. No longer use DOWN key.
Jip de Beer
When not in movie mode, deactivate toggle menu and handle INFO key as normal.
Jip de Beer
Moved presets toggle menu into it's own top level menu. Open with double INFO press.
Jip de Beer
Merged latest changes from Danne. EOSM,100D,isoclimb also while filming.
danne
crop_rec.c:(EOSM,100D,isoclimb also while filming)
Jip de Beer
Toggle presets with single INFO press, show message on double press. Menu open on double press not yet implemented.
Jip de Beer
Removed a leftover NotifyBox.
Jip de Beer
Figured out how to do do stuff on single and double keypress. Currently only showing a message with NotifyBox on INFO single and double press.
JipHop
Handle INFO key as normal when preset slots are empty.
JipHop
Added presets toggle submenu.
Jip de Beer
Created new branch crop_rec_4k_mlv_snd_isogain_1x3_presets_toggle
danne
mlv_lite.c:(EOSM,100D testing to kill global draw while pushing halfshutter when in framing preview mode, hopefully less corrupted frames)
danne
crop_rec.c:(EOSM changing startoff presets fixes)
danne
mlv_lite.c:(EOSM enables Kill global draw when 48fps preset is running in rel time preview mode)
danne
crop_rec.c:(EOSM refining startoff preset)
danne
crop_rec.c:(EOSM startoff preset mcm set to 14bit instead of 12bit)
danne
crop_rec.c:(EOSM more startoff presets. Not really needed but see where it leads in the end)
danne
crop_rec.c:(EOSM presets added)
danne
crop_rec.c:(eosm Startoff select testing)
danne
crop_rec.c:(EOSM pausing some things(fallback experimantal tests)
danne
crop_rec.c:(EOSM fallback presets. Experimental)
danne
crop_rec.c:(EOSM fixed stuck preview while in 3K and no ratio was set using x10 focus aid)
danne
crop_rec.c:(cleaning...)
danne
crop_rec.c:(EOSM small change to x10 focus aid)
danne
lua script update
danne
crop_rec.c:(EOSM x5 zoom better handled with x10 focus aid)
danne
mlv_lite.c:(kill global draw issue anamorphic modes fixed)
danne
crop_rec.c:(cleaning...)
danne
crop_rec.c:(isoclimb fix for eosm and 100d. Todo 5D3, not refreshing)
danne
crop_rec.c:(Putting isoclimb aside. Not working properly atm)
danne
crop_rec.c:(iso climb preset. Fixed a bug where it would report iso 100. Assigned press down button instead of INFO button)
danne
crop_rec.c:(autoiso warning when using iso climb)
danne
crop_rec.c:(5D3 added iso climb button)
danne
crop_rec.c:(100D added iso climb preset)
danne
crop_rec.c:(trick menu selections so it only shows on/off)
danne
crop_rec.c:(iso climbing preset. Fast access to iso with INFO buttopn)
danne
crop_rec.c:(bugfix)
danne
crop_rec.c:(also needed for mlv_play)
danne
crop_rec.c:(selectable x3toggle button, SET or thrashcan)
danne
crop_rec.c:(100D bugs with clock function)
danne
crop_rec.c:(only use bmp on or off when recording)
danne
crop_rec.c:(iso 100 not a fan of this)
danne
crop_rec.c:(corrected black/tint/greens previewing)
danne
crop_rec.c:(EOSM,100D Correct for autoiso pushing analog gain when rawiso hits the roof)
danne
crop_rec.c:(exclude also 6D of course)
danne
crop_rec.c:(including 6D to max iso preset, thanks Levas for iso regs)
danne
mlv_lite.c,crop_rec.c:(bugfixes. Conflicting dummy regs)
danne
crop_rec.c.mlv_lite.c,lens.c:(max iso added 400+,800+,1600+)
danne
crop_rec.c:(bugfixes around autoiso)
danne
crop_rec.c:(help text)
danne
crop_rec.c:(fixing metadata iso max iso preset)
danne
crop_rec.c:(push this for a while. Iso metadata needs to be fixed auto iso)
danne
crop_rec.c:(Notifybox typo)
danne
crop_rec.c:(fixed long time autiso bug when recording iso 100)
danne
crop_rec:(EOSM,100D,5D3 trying to restrict auto iso with max iso 800)
danne
crop_rec.c:(100D at least one stubborn double round less)
danne
crop_rec.c:(EOSM autoiso working better with x10 focus aid function)
danne
crop_rec.c:(more polishing)
danne
crop_rec.c:(polishing)
danne
crop_rec.c:(focus aid help text changes)
danne
crop_rec.c:(dark mode but with slower fps, not 5D3 and 6D)
danne
crop_rec.c:(x10 focusu aid. Fix for when in canon menu and leaving)
danne
crop_rec.c:(EOSM x3toggle default per install. Precision work)
danne
crop_rec.c:(x3toggle, trash can button eosm, halfshutter otherwise)
danne
crop_rec.c:(x3toggle reassigning garbage can button short press for toggling x3 and x1 modes)
danne
crop_rec.c:(6D,5D3 focus aid implemented by short cutting into crop_rec_polling_cbr)
danne
crop_rec.c:(typo)
danne
crop_rec.c:(instruction change zoom aid)
danne
crop_rec.c:(x10 zoom aid also working in photo mode)
danne
crop_rec.c:(EOSM,100D etc. x10toggle renamed "zoom aid" changed to exisitning function set_lv_zoom(10);)
danne
crop_rec.c:(EOSM missed a few x10toggle centering presets)
danne
crop_rec.c(EOSM,100D refined centering x10toggle certain modes)
danne
crop_rec.c:(100D x3crop mode preset centering)
danne
crop_rec.c:(typo)
danne
mlv_lite.c:(back in with this. On 5D3 framing still keep running otherwise despite pushing halfshutter)
danne
crop_rec.c:(x10toggle fix. Causing corruption otherwise)
danne
crop_rec.c:(typo)
danne
mlv_lite.c:(causing all kinds of corruption. Regretting change. Todo: check anomaly with 5D3)
danne
crop_rec.c:(additional info)
danne
crop_rec.c:(Good info)
danne
crop_rec.c:(cleaning out obsolete code)
danne
crop_rec.c,mlv_lite.c(All cams, x10toggle feature, zoom aid. Ideas from theBilalFakhouri here https://www.magiclantern.fm/forum/index.php?topic=24288.msg218209#msg218209)
danne
crop_rec.c:(EOSM lot to think about. aliasing regs)
danne
crop_rec.c:(EOSM reg 8000 fix)
danne
crop_rec.c:(EOSM refining anamorphic previewing)
danne
crop_rec.c:(EOSM real time preview around anamorphic while not recording)
danne
crop_rec.c:(anamorphic modes stronger centering. x3toggle too. Thanks masc for feedback)
danne
crop_rec.c:(EOSM recording correct 3x3 metadata. Has been 1x1 for a while now)
danne
crop_rec.c:(EOSM more issues previewing, reverting)
danne
crop_rec.c:(EOSM new preview reg for eosm not working with x5 zoom)
danne
crop_rec.c:(removing interfering code)
danne
crop_rec.c(EOSM better register for preview gain 10bit)
danne
crop_rec.c:(EOSM x3crop toggle aid also for non rewired anamorphic preset)
danne
crop_rec.c:(100D stubborn so an extra pass is needed)
danne
crop_rec.c:(readibilty)
danne
crop_rec.c:(EOSM,100D crop toggle for anamorphic 5k mode. Not too good working with 100D)
danne
crop_rec.c:(100D might work a little better here)
danne
crop_rec.c:(EOSM x3crop toggle, removing delay)
danne
crop_rec.c:(eosm x2crop toggle. Better response time)
danne
mlv_lite.c:(sloppy miss)
danne
lua.c:(missed a spot. Thanks Jip-Hop)
danne
mlv_lite.c:(EOSM,100D causing errors on 100D)
danne
crop_rec.c:(EOSM,5D3 excluding not used presets, erasing test line)
danne
crop_rec.c:(5D3 added x3toggle mode for 45/48/50&60 fps)
danne
crop_rec.c:(EOSM x3crop toggle first version. Halfpress shutter to toggle between x3 and normal mode)
danne
crop_rec.c:(5D3 reducing height a bit 60fps)
danne
crop_rec.c:(5D3 refining 713c)
danne
crop:rec.c:(5D3 refinied 713c fo 60fps)
danne
crop_rec.c:(5D3 x3crop mode now working with higher frame rates 45/48/50/50 fps)
danne
mlv_lite.c:(accidental erase)
danne
mlv_lite.c,crop_rec.c(100D,EOSM patch when restarting. Avoid bypassing crop_rec registers)
danne
crop_rec.c:(5D3 refining)
danne
crop_rec.c:(5D3 refining 60fps mode)
danne
crop_rec.c:(5D3 adding reg connectors)
danne
crop_rec.c:(5D3 1920x816 possible in 60fps)
danne
crop_rec.c:(100D fix for previewing mv720p mode)
danne
crop_rec.c:(5D3 50/60 fps separated. Works with both pal and ntsc. Freedom)
danne
crop_rec.c,mlv_lite.c,raw.c:(5D3 well, testing 50fps but not sure what will work)
danne
fps-engio.c,crop-mode-hack.c:(compiler warnings)
danne
lua.c:(Not compiling without updating this)
danne
crop_rec.c:(EOSM added shutter blanking in 4k timelapse mode. Caveat. Slow fps also means slow liveview timing updates)
danne
property.h,tasks,c,propvalues.c:(Will reveal incomplete shutdowns https://bitbucket.org/hudson/magic-lantern/commits/99301f4fe05beddde611a1a8746aac52bf9e29f1)
danne
crop_rec.c,mlv_lite.c,raw.c:(5D3 back to older preview routine around analog gain reduction)
danne
sd_uhs.c:(100D mainly but will work better for all included cams)
danne
sd_uhs.c:(removing more code)
danne
zebras.c:(All cams. Let´s not enable magic zoom per default. Interferes too much)
danne
mlv_lite.c:(EOSM,100D volatile reg workaround while previewing works without getting stuck)
danne
crop_rec.c,mlv_lite.c,lens.c(EOSM,100D 4k timelapse meta and display data)
danne
crop_rec.c:(5D3 still compression errors 50fps mode 3x3 it seems. Testing further)
danne
features.h:(EOSM added define possibility for junkie menu)
danne
crop_rec.c:(5D3 include x5zoom automation)
danne
crop_rec.c(5DIII better timer)
danne
lua:(cinema script updated)
danne
crop_rec.c:(5DIII bug fix when recording 50/60p)
danne
crop_rec.c:(5DIII mv720p modes 45/48/59/60 fps better worka round when going out of x10 zoom)
danne
mlv_lite.c(works just as good)
danne
crop_rec.c(anamorphic modes preview preset added. Not very useful atm. Thanks to Pacerc999 https://www.magiclantern.fm/forum/index.php?topic=9741.msg217537#msg217537)
danne
crop_rec.c:(EOSM 3k reworked)
danne
crop_rec.c:(cleaning)
danne
crop_rec.c,mlv_lite.c(EOSM 4k continuous, various ratios, preview connectors)
danne
crop_rec.c:(EOSM reworked 4k preset. Timelapse added. todo:preview regs in mlv_lite.c)
danne
crop_rec.c:(EOSM seems to handle fps override and shutter blanking better. Not sure why)
danne
crop_rec.c:(100D displaying correct info)
danne
crop_rec.c:(100D 4k options non timelapse mode)
danne
crop_rec.c,mlv_lite.c:(EOSM,100D set dummy reg for half color preview in mlv_lite.c)
danne
mlv_lite.c:(100D,EOSM half color resolution while using timelapse presets 14bit lossless)
danne
crop_rec.c:(100D,EOSM info screen)
danne
crop_rec.c:(100D missed three presets, timelapse)
danne
crop_rec.c,mlv_lite.c:(100D major implementation timelapse routine. 5k included)
danne
crop_rec.c:(100D more to it)
danne
crop_rec.c:(100D fix for first corrupt frame)
danne
crop_rec.c:(100D,EOSM reducing width(borders))
danne
crop_rec.c:(100D 4280x3000 timelapse mode)
danne
crop_rec.c:(EOSM border issue
danne
crop_rec.c(100D,EOSM border fix)
danne
mlv_lite.c:(EOSM corrected reg)
danne
crop_rec.c.mlv_lite.c:(100D,EOSM preview regs)
danne
crop:rec.c:(100D highest resolution now 4056x3004 with up to 2fps)
danne
crop_rec.c,mlv_lite.c:(100D height expansion 4k when timelapsing)
danne
crop_rec.c:(EOSM adtg expansion)
danne
crop_rec.c:(EOSM,100D better place for code)
danne
crop_rec.c,mlv_lite.c:(EOSM,100D fixing correct white level)
danne
crop_rec.c(100D, EOSM routines for timelapse. EOSM works different. Needs much testing)
danne
crop_rec.c:(EOSM 9fps for 4k preset)
danne
crop_rec.c:(100D fix roundtrip. eosm inclusion. not ready yet)
danne
crop_rec.c:(100D timelapse function now with slowshutter)
danne
crop_rec.c:(100D,EOSM timelapse function in crop mode sub menu)
danne
crop_rec.c:(100D menu description)
danne
crop_rec.c:(100D timelapse functionality 4K preset only)
danne
crop_rec.c:(100D timelapse preset 4k. Preview in 9fps, once recording reduces to 2.86fps)
danne
crop_rec.c, mlv_lite.c:(100D 4k mode reduced to 7fps, slightly reduced resolution)
danne
crop_rec.c:(EOSM including bigger anamorphic rewired buffer)
danne
typo
danne
typo
danne
crop_rec.c:(100D, EOSM etc. Guess smarter place to put this return)
danne
crop_rec.c:(100D, EOSM etc. Not enter x5 mode when in photo mode and crop_rec is enabled)
danne
lua cinema script:(typo)
danne
lua cinema script:(EOSM now starts out with 2.39:1 4K anamorphic rewired preset)
danne
crop_rec.c:(EOSM 2.39:1 added to all presets)
danne
lua:(update cinema script to 2.39:1 as default set up)
danne
crop_rec.c:(eosm,100d,5d3 adding 2.39:1 preset, still more todo on eosm...)
danne
sd_uhs.c:(typo)
danne
mlv_lite.c:(100D af_on small_hacks. Autofocus while recording)
danne
sd_uhs.c:(EOSM2 added direct patching)
danne
crop_rec.c:(refining timers 30fps mcm mode)